percolate

per·co·late

percolate

 
pronunciation:
puhr k leIt
parts of speech:
transitive verb, intransitive verb
features:
Word Combinations (verb), Word Parts
part of speech: transitive verb
inflections: percolates, percolating, percolated
definition 1: to cause (a liquid) to trickle or pass through something porous, such as a filter.
similar words:
trickle
definition 2: to trickle or move slowly through.
The excess fluid percolated the soil.
definition 3: to brew (coffee) by filtering hot water through ground coffee.
 
part of speech: intransitive verb
definition 1: to pass slowly through a filter or other porous substance; filter through something.
similar words:
filter
definition 2: to brew in a coffee percolator.
The coffee percolates quickly in this pot.
definition 3: to be or become active or lively.
This office is finally beginning to percolate.
